Why Solar-Powered AC Makes Sense for Indonesian Drivers
With average temperatures hovering around 28°C year-round, car air conditioning isn't a luxury in Indonesia – it's a necessity. Traditional systems can increase fuel consumption by up to 20%, but solar alternatives offer compelling advantages:
- 30-50% reduction in fuel costs for cooling
- Extended battery life through reduced engine load
- Lower carbon emissions (up to 1 ton/year per vehicle)
- Continuous cooling even when engine is off
How Solar Car AC Systems Work
Modern systems combine three key components:
- Flexible solar panels integrated into vehicle roofs
- High-efficiency DC compressor units
- Smart energy management systems

Implementation Challenges and Solutions
While promising, adoption faces hurdles:
- Upfront costs: Solar AC systems currently add $400-$800 to vehicle price
- Installation expertise: Only 23% of workshops offer certified installation
- Consumer awareness: 61% of buyers unaware of solar AC options
